Highlighted works
Filmography
2015
nightclub attendee/climax player
2014
Lee Watson
2011
Ned Pick
2007
cast member
2007
cast member
2005
cast member
2003
Guy Maddin
2003
The Saddest Music in the World
Teddy
1999
cast member
1997
cast member
1997
cast member
1997
cast member